当前位置:首页 > 系统教程 > 正文

MySQL安装指南(CentOS7环境下从零开始部署数据库)

MySQL安装指南(CentOS7环境下从零开始部署数据库)

本教程将详细介绍在CentOS7操作系统上安装MySQL数据库的步骤,涵盖MySQL安装CentOS7教程数据库配置Linux服务器管理等关键SEO知识点,适合小白用户跟随操作。MySQL是一种流行的开源关系型数据库,广泛应用于Web开发和服务器管理。

一、准备工作

在开始安装前,请确保您有一台运行CentOS7的服务器或虚拟机,并具有root或sudo权限。打开终端,执行以下命令更新系统包,以确保软件最新:

sudo yum update -y

这一步是CentOS7教程的基础,有助于避免兼容性问题。

二、安装MySQL服务器

CentOS7默认仓库可能不包含最新MySQL,因此需要添加MySQL官方仓库。执行以下命令下载并安装MySQL仓库:

sudo wget https://dev.mysql.com/get/mysql80-community-release-el7-3.noarch.rpmsudo rpm -ivh mysql80-community-release-el7-3.noarch.rpm

接下来,进行MySQL安装:安装MySQL服务器包:

sudo yum install mysql-server -y

安装过程可能需要几分钟,请耐心等待。完成后,您将看到成功消息。

MySQL安装指南(CentOS7环境下从零开始部署数据库) MySQL安装  CentOS7教程 数据库配置 Linux服务器 第1张

三、配置和启动MySQL服务

安装完成后,启动MySQL服务并设置开机自启:

sudo systemctl start mysqldsudo systemctl enable mysqld

检查服务状态,确保运行正常:

sudo systemctl status mysqld

接下来,进行安全配置,这是数据库配置的关键步骤。运行MySQL安全脚本,设置root密码和其他安全选项:

sudo mysql_secure_installation

按照提示操作:设置强密码、移除匿名用户、禁止远程root登录等。这有助于提升Linux服务器的安全性。

四、测试安装

登录MySQL数据库,验证安装是否成功:

mysql -u root -p

输入设置的root密码后,您将进入MySQL shell。执行简单命令,如显示数据库:

SHOW DATABASES;

如果看到系统数据库列表,则MySQL安装成功。退出MySQL shell:输入exit

五、总结

通过本教程,您已在CentOS7上完成了MySQL数据库的安装、配置和测试。这涵盖了CentOS7教程的核心操作,并为后续的数据库配置打下基础。如果在Linux服务器管理中遇到问题,请参考官方文档或社区资源。定期更新和维护是确保数据库安全运行的关键。